    Fire sleeve on return line and an adapter? whuufer??

    FYI, that firesleeve works really well. 2.3 Ford turbo's are notorious for cooking plug wires, but I found that putting this over the wires where the heat was exposed to them made a good set of silicon wires last indefinitely.     Mobile Delvac Rebates = Cheap Oil

    Passing this along for anybody who needs an oil change for their IDI. I got a 2.5 gallon jug of Mobile Delvac Super 1300 at Wally World for $31.67, which qualifies for a $10 prepaid Visa card. When you sign up online, they give you another $5 Visa card. That's 2.5 gallons for $16.67 plus tax...
